Avatar billede blackscorpion Nybegynder
29. januar 2006 - 16:57 Der er 4 kommentarer og
1 løsning

Får Blank Side.

Hej Eksperter.

Sidder her med et mega problem...

har en side som virker perfekt på min, ingen problemer osv.

men når jeg så smider den op på min "kundes" webhotel, får jeg blank side.

Side der kan se hvad der er galt ? fejl osv.

- BlackScorpion.

Koden ser sådan her ud.

------------------------------------

<?php

session_start();

require("../admin/config.inc.php");
require("../includes/functions.inc.php");

?>
<html>
<head>
  <style type="text/css">
  .td.header {
    font-size: 12px;
    color: #000000;
    border-bottom: 1px solid #CCCCCC;
  }
 
  A:link, A:visited, A:active {
    color: #000000;
    text-decoration: none;
    font-size: 12px;
  }
 
  A:hover {
    text-decoration: underline;
    color: #000000;
    font-size: 12px;
  } 
 
  input {
    border: 1px solid black;
    font-size: 12px;
  }
 
  .content {
    font-size: 12px;
  }
  </style>
 
  <script type="text/javascript">
    function valider(){
      var kl1 = document.getElementById('kl1');
      var kl2 = document.getElementById('kl2');
      var regexp = new RegExp('([0-1][0-9]|2[0-3])\.[0-5][0-9]$');
     
      if (kl1.value == kl2.value) {
        alert('Du skal angive 2 forskellige tidspunkter.');
        return false;
      }
      else if(kl1.value > kl2.value) {
        alert('Det angivet \'Fra\' tidspunkt er senere det angivet \'Til\' tidspunkt');
        return false;
      }
      else if (!kl1.value.match(regexp)){
        alert('Det angivet \'Fra\' tidspunkt er ugyldigt.');
        return false;
      }
      else if (!kl2.value.match(regexp)) {
        alert('Det angivet \'Til\' tidspunkt er ugyldigt.');
        return false;
      }
      else{
        return true;
      }
    }
  </script>
 
</head>
<body topmargin="5" leftmargin="5">

<table cellpadding="0" cellspacing="0" border="0" width="100%">
  <tr>
  <td class="header">
<?php

$day_names = array(0 => 'Søndag', 'Mandag', 'Tirsdag', 'Onsdag', 'Torsdag', 'Fredag', 'Lørdag');

$month = date('m', $_REQUEST['date']);
$month_name = date('F', $_REQUEST['date']);

switch($month) {
    case "01": $month_name = "Januar"; break;
    case "02": $month_name = "Februar"; break;
    case "03": $month_name = "Marts"; break;
    case "05": $month_name = "Maj"; break;
    case "06": $month_name = "Juni"; break;
    case "07": $month_name = "Juli"; break;
    case "10": $month_name = "Oktober"; break;
}

$day_name = date("w", $_REQUEST['date']);
$day = $day_names[$day_name];

echo $day ." d. ".date("j", $_REQUEST['date'])." ".$month_name." ".date("Y", $_REQUEST['date']);

?>
  </td>
  <td align="right" class="header">
    <a href="#" onclick="parent.hideBox(); parent.location.reload(true)">Luk Vindue</a><br>
  </td>
  </tr>
  <tr>
  <td colspan="2" align="center" class="content">   
    <br style="font-size: 5px">
    Kan arbejde: <br>
   
    <table cellpadding="0" cellspacing="0" border="0" width="200" class="content">
    <tr>
      <form action="popup_date_update.php" method="POST" name="reg" onsubmit="return valider();">
      <td align="right">
<?php

connect($mysql_host, $mysql_user, $mysql_pass, '********');

$sql = "select * from scanvikar.calendar1 where userid = '$_SESSION[cprnr]' AND int_date = '$_REQUEST[date]'";

if(mysql_num_rows($result = mysql_query($sql))) {
  while($content = mysql_fetch_array($result)) {
  extract($content);
 
  echo "<input type=\"hidden\" name=\"int_date\" value=\"".$_REQUEST['date']."\">\n";
  echo "<input type=\"hidden\" name=\"new\" value=\"no\">\n";
  echo "Fra : <input type=\"text\" name=\"work_start\" value=\"" . $work_start . "\" id=\"kl1\" onblur=\"this.value = this.value.replace(':','.');\" maxlength=\"5\" onclick=\"this.value=''\"><br>\n";
  echo "Til : <input type=\"text\" name=\"work_end\" value=\"".$work_end . "\" id=\"kl2\" onblur=\"this.value = this.value.replace(':','.');\" maxlength=\"5\" onclick=\"this.value=''\"><br>\n";
  echo "<input type=\"submit\" value=\" Opdater \"><br>\n";
  }
}
else {
  echo "<input type=\"hidden\" name=\"int_date\" value=\"".$_REQUEST['date']."\">\n";
  echo "<input type=\"hidden\" name=\"new\" value=\"yes\">\n";
  echo "Fra : <input type=\"text\" name=\"work_start\" id=\"kl1\" value=\"00.00\" onblur=\"this.value = this.value.replace(':','.');\" maxlength=\"5\" onclick=\"this.value=''\"><br>\n";
  echo "Til : <input type=\"text\" name=\"work_end\" id=\"kl2\" value=\"00.00\" onblur=\"this.value = this.value.replace(':','.');\" maxlength=\"5\" onclick=\"this.value=''\"><br>\n";
  echo "<input type=\"submit\" value=\" Opdater \"><br>\n"; 
}


?>
    </td>
    </form>
    </tr>
  </table>
 
  </td>
  </tr>
</table>

</body>
</html>

---------------------------
Avatar billede torbens_dk Nybegynder
29. januar 2006 - 17:08 #1
Mangle webhoteller undertrykker php advarsler og fejl. Derfor kommer den en blank side
Avatar billede blackscorpion Nybegynder
29. januar 2006 - 17:12 #2
jamen ved du hvad jeg kan gøre ved det ??
Avatar billede blackscorpion Nybegynder
29. januar 2006 - 17:20 #3
okey har løst problemet... havde fået rykker en fil, så lukker og slukker, men tak for dit svar. ;)
Avatar billede torbens_dk Nybegynder
29. januar 2006 - 17:23 #4
Så var det jo faktisk det, fordi du ikke fik fejl beskeden. :-)
Avatar billede blackscorpion Nybegynder
29. januar 2006 - 17:27 #5
det er faktisk rigtigt nok, manglede en fejl besked om filen ikke kunne findes... men har fået det på de andre sider, derfor jeg ikke tænke på at det måske var en fil der manglede.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ester